I searched under 2002 CL and TL and got the same results:

NHTSA Action Number : PE02081
NHTSA Recall Campign Number : N/A
Make : ACURA Model: 3.2CL
Manufacturer : AMERICAN HONDA MOTOR CO. Year : 2002
Component : POWER TRAIN:AUTOMATIC TRANSMISSION
Date Investigation Opened : October 28, 2002
Date Investigation Closed : March 5, 2003
Summary: ALLEGE THAT THE AUTOMATIC ANSMISSION/TRANSA.LE MAY SEIZE OR LOCKUP OR SHIFT GEARS UNEXPECTEDLY, CAUSING VEHICLE DECELERATION, OR DISENGAGE FULLY, CAUSING LOSS OF MOTIVE POWER.
